Veeranna Madiwalar - Behind Every Step
Veeranna Madiwalar, a 39-year-old, has turned Nidagundi Ambedkar School in Vijayapur, Karnataka, from a run-down place into a lively, engaging space for learning. With its colorful walls, updated facilities, and a library full of picture books and multimedia resources, the school now attracts more village children, boosting its enrollment from 76 to 136 students. Veeranna emphasized that it took a team to bring about this remarkable transformation, resulting in a school where the children genuinely enjoy studying.
Growing up in a financially struggling family, Veeranna was determined to improve education for future generations. Supported by his uncle during his early education, Veeranna read about Rabindranath Tagore – a source of inspiration that drove him to work towards his goals. He took up multiple jobs to fund his higher education. Eventually, he completed a Diploma in Education, worked at an NGO for lake and wildlife rejuvenation, and pursued a master's degree in English and Kannada, all while saving money from his various earnings. In 2007, Veeranna fulfilled his long-held dream of becoming a government school teacher.
When Veeranna took over as the headmaster of Nidagundi Ambedkar School in 2016, he kick-started a transformational journey using his own savings. He started by greening the school and renovating the crumbling infrastructure. Recognizing the need for more financial support, he leveraged social media to raise funds by sharing his efforts, resulting in much-needed assistance. Thanks to his initiative, he sought donations to build new bathrooms, repair furniture, and acquire new ones. Generous contributions from supporters even helped establish a language lab equipped with visual aids and resources for studying English and Kannada.
Veeranna firmly believes in living his dreams through the success of his students, marking his story as one of devotion, resilience, and impactful transformation.
